The work of our construction manager Vašek is coming to an end, and in order to stay on schedule we are even working on weekends. In Kashitu, the WiFi was down for half the week, so nothing distracted us from the construction site. Thanks to the tireless efforts of our workers, we have achieved great progress – the masonry phase has been completed all the way up to the reinforcing ring beam! The new site manager, Honza, can therefore seamlessly continue with the construction, and at the beginning of next week we will be lifting the first roof truss. In addition to building the honey house, we have also started preparations for installing the photovoltaic system, which should be the final step of this construction period.

We are restarting the carpentry workshop! At first, the carpenters supported our construction team by preparing the formwork for the ring beam. Since the material for the beekeeping workshop's hives took longer to arrive, they meanwhile focused on making benches for the local church. An intensive training program for beekeeping trainers is currently underway. People from different communities came to Kashitu and spent a whole week actively learning. They truly appreciated the valuable knowledge shared by our experienced beekeeper, Mr. Thomas. The workshop also included a presentation of our products – beekeeping suits, hives, smokers, and swarm boxes.

We opened our very first composter! This will allow the local community to make efficient use of organic waste for soil fertilization while also reducing the burning of trash.
